ROLLING PROCEDURE
INITIAL CHECK UP
1. CHECK WHETHER ALL TURBINE AUXILIARY EQUIPMENTS ARE IN SERVICE.
2. INFORM THE ROLLING PARAMETERS AFTER VERIFYING MAXIMUM METAL
TEMPERATURE.
3. CONFIRM WHETHER ALL DRAINS TO IBD/FB INCLUDING MAL DRAINS AND ITS
RESPECTIVE GATE VALVES ARE IN OPEN CONDITION.
4. OPEN HP B/P ATMOSPHERIC DRAINS.
5. CHECK WHETHER LUBE OIL TCV IS IN AUTO AND THE TEMPERATURE SETTING IS
AT 45 0 C.
6. STEAM TO SEALS CAN BE FED FROM AST PREFERABLY FROM STAGE I FOR ITS
LOWER TEMPERATURE.
7. CHECK WHETHER THERE IS SUFFICIENT VACUUM IN THE CONDENSER.
8. CHECK WHETHER ALL TEST VALVES OF STOP VALVES ARE IN OPEN CONDITION.
9. CHECK CUT OUT VALVES FOR EHC AND CRH PILOT VALVE ARE IN OPEN CONDITION.
10. RECORD ALL SUPERVISORY READINGS.
11. CHECK WHETHER POWER SUPPLY FOR K 101 & 201 IS AVAILABLE.
12. CHECK FOR ANY ABNORMAL ALARMS IN ANNUNCIATION PANEL.
13. CHECK WHETHER ALL INSTRUMENTS REQUIRED FOR ROLLING ARE HEALTHY.
14. ENSURE THAT THERE ARE NO TRIP SIGNALS PRESENT.
ROLLING THROUGH EHC
SPEEDER GEAR SHOULD BE IN THE MAXIMUM POSITION.
CHECK THE EHC CONTROL DESK FOR THE FOLLOWING:
LP MODE SELECTION
NO FAULT IN EHC
SPEED CONTROL ACTIVE DISPLAY
TRACKING DEVICE OFF
SPEED SET POINT ZERO.
HEALTHINESS OF STARTING DEVICE AND SPEEDER GEAR MOTOR.
LOAD CONTROLLER ON
LOAD SET POINT APPROXIMATELY TO 30 MW IN PR LIMITER.
LOAD GRADIENT ON AND LOADING RATE SET AT 4 MW/MIN.
1. AS SOON AS THE PARAMETERS FOR OPENING STOP VALVES IS OBTAINED, BRING
DOWN THE STARTING DEVICE TO 0 % TO OPEN THE STOP VALVES
2. STEAM TEMPERATURE SHOULD BE 50OC MORE THAN CONTROL VALVE BODY
TEMPERATURE AND SHOULD BE IN SUPER HEATED REGION WITH RESPECT TO MS
PRESSURE.
3. INFORM GENERATOR BOARD TO RESET THE PROTECTION RELAYS IN GRP.
4. AFTER RESETTING, OBSERVE TRIP OIL PRESS RISE & RESETTING OF ‘TURBINE
TRIPPED’ ALARM.
5. IF THE TRIP OIL PRESS IS LESS, ROTATE THE SELF CLEANING FILTERS IN THE
GOVERNING RACK
6. RISE THE STARTING AND LOAD LIMITER SLOWLY AND CHECK FOR OPENING OF
STOP VALVES AFTER OBSERVING START UP OIL PRESSURE.
7. MS 25, 26, HR 47, 48(15, 16) CAN BE CHOCKED AFTER ENSURING FLOW THROUGH
RESPECTIVE MAL DRAINS.
8. RAISE THE STARTING AND LOAD LIMITER TO MAXIMUM POSITION.
9. SPEEDER GEAR SHOULD BE AT MAXIMUM POSITION IF ROLLING HAS TO BE DONE
THROUGH EHC.
10. SLOWLY RAISE SPEED SET POINT IN EHC TO 600 RPM.
11. OBSERVE THE SPEED RISE AND VIBRATION.
12. HOLD IT AT 600 RPM FOR ABOUT 10 MINUTES & RECORD THE SIP READINGS
INCLUDING BEARING METAL TEMPS
13. OBSERVE TSE MARGINS FOR CONTROL VALVES
14. AGAIN RAISE THE SPEED SET POINT WITHOUT ANY INTERRUPTION TILL THE SET
POINT REACHES 3000 RPM.
15. RECORD THE SPEEDS AT WHICH GATE VALE GEARING CLOSES AND JOP A STOPS.
16. RECORD THE SPEED AT WHICH MAXIMUM SHAFT AND PEDESTAL VIBRATIONS
OCCUR.
17. AFTER REACHING 3000 RPM INFORM GENERATOR BOARD FOR SYNCHRONIZING.
18. IF THE HOLDING TIME IS MORE THAN 15 MINS, HPT EXHAUST TEMPERATURE IS
TO BE MONITORED.
19. UNIT IS TO BE SYNCHRONIZED PREFERABLY THROUGH AUTO SYNCHRONIZER AND
SYNCHRONSCOPE INDICATION SHOULD BE IN THE CLOCKWISE DIRECTION.
(TURBINE SPEED GREATER THAN GRID SPEED)
20. ENSURE CLOSING (CLOSE INDICATION OF GENERATOR BREAKER) DURING
SYNCHRONIZING AND ‘AUTO’ RISE IN SPEED SET POINT FOR BLOCK LOAD. IF
SPEED SET POINT NOT RISES ON AUTO, THEN ADDITIONAL 10 RPM SETTING CAN
BE RAISED TO PREVENT UNIT TRIPPING ON REVERSE POWER PROTECTION.
21. AFTER ENSURING LOAD CONTROL LOOP TAKING OVER, LOAD SHOULD BE RAISED
ONLY THROUGH LOAD LOOP. IN CASE OF ANY SPEED/LOAD LOOP CHANGER OVER
NOTICED SET POINT TO BE RAISED PREFERABLY IN LOAD LOOP (PR).
ROLLING THROUGH MHG
1. CLOSE THE EHC CUT OUT VALVES.
2. BRING DOWN THE SPEEDER GEAR TO MINIMUM POSITION.
3. EHC SPEED SET POINT CAN BE RAISED TO MAXIMUM.
4. OPEN STOP VALVES AS MENTIONED EARLIER.
5. SLOWLY RAISE THE STARTING DEVICE; AT APPROXIMATELY 60% THE CONTROL
VALVES BEGIN TO OPEN.
6. WAIT FOR THE SPEED TO SETTLE AT APPROXIMATELY 600 RPM.
7. AFTER OBSERVING SIP READINGS SLOWLY RAISE STARTING DEVICE AND AT
APPROXIMATELY 2400RPM SPEEDER GEAR WILL TAKE OVER FROM STARTING
DEVICE AND STARTING DEVICE CAN BE WITHDRAWN.
8. THEN RAISE THE SPEED THROUGH SPEEDER GEAR AND AT APPROXIMATELY AT
50% POSITION OF SPEEDER GEAR, 3000 RPM WILL BE REACHED
9. SYNCHRONIZE THE UNIT AND BLOCK LOAD TO BE RAISED IN SPEEDER GEAR
MANUALLY.
LOAD RISING:
1. SLOWLY RAISE THE LOAD AND TEMPERATURE ADHERING TO ABT SCHEDULE AND
TSE.
2. ALWAYS STRESS MARGIN HAS TO BE CHASED WHILE RAISING THE LOAD.
